Nekita Thomas is a designer, educator, and researcher dedicated to using design as a tool for social impact. She believes in the power of designing tools and spaces for critical conversation and knowledge exchange to generate new ideas and solutions. This requires always asking the “what ifs” and “why nots” and enabling diverse perspectives to come together. This is the basis of her current projects on topics of race, racism, well-being, and the built environment.
Nekita teaches in Graphic Design and Design for Responsible Innovation at The University of Illinois at Urbana Champaign.
